Museum village De Locht

At Museum de Locht, you step back in time. Between historic buildings, old crafts and authentic living quarters, you will discover what life in the North Limburg countryside used to be like. From the clothes they wore to the food on the table: there's a story behind everything.


Here you walk through a small, traditional northern Limburg village. A place full of stories about rural life. How people used to live, work and cook. What clothes they wore and how the land was worked. Rain or shine, there is always something to discover at De Locht. Spread over more than three hectares are some twenty buildings and gardens. Take a look at a fully furnished 19th-century farmhouse or find out what life was like on a medieval farm. Visit the smithy, the syrup factory and the textile pavilion. There is more to see here than you can comprehend in one day. De Locht connects past and present. You will learn all about growing mushrooms and asparagus and follow the development of greenhouse farming. Herbs, soft fruit and forgotten vegetables grow in the gardens. There are regular demonstrations of old crafts. The auction clock runs, syrup is cooked and fresh bread is baked. For children, there are (digital) scavenger hunts, Old Dutch games and changing activities. Special: Museum village De Locht is even recreated in ROBLOX. So you can also discover the village from home.
